{{Short description|Island in Marie Byrd Land, Antarctica}} {{no footnotes|date=August 2019}} {{Infobox islands | name = Pranke Island | pushpin_map = Antarctica | country = ATA | location = Russell Bay | coordinates = {{Coord|73|14|S|124|55|W|format=dms|display=inline,title|region:AQ_type:isle}} }} '''Pranke Island''' is a small ice-covered island lying close to Siple Island in the west extremity of Russell Bay, off the coast of Marie Byrd Land. Mapped by United States Geological Survey (USGS) from ground surveys and U.S. Navy air photos, 1959–65. Named by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names (US-ACAN) for James B. Pranke, aurora researcher at Byrd Station in 1965.
